It's Go Time for Roslindale Square's Parkside on Adams

New, 1 comment


'Tis officially the Era of the Shovel in Boston as more and more development eases into the pipeline or gets under way. Add Parkside on Adams in Roslindale (or New West Roxbury, if you prefer). The redevelopment of the old power substation in Roslindale Square, as well as the nearby site of a former funeral home, into apartments and commercial space has been a long-time a-comin'. Construction got under way last week. The substation itself will be turned into a two-level hub of offices, entertainment and retail, including a restaurant or restaurants. The nearby lot will become 43 studio, 1-BR and 2-BR apartments with 38 parking spaces and a "green" roof deck (and six of the units will be designated affordable). Everything's supposed to wrap up by next summer. Stay tuned.
